基于AT89S52单片机的超声波测距系统设计  被引量:3

Design of A Ultrasonic Ranging System based on AT89S52

在线阅读下载全文

作  者:姚存治[1] 王大文[1] 

机构地区:[1]郑州铁路职业技术学院,河南郑州450052

出  处:《郑州铁路职业技术学院学报》2015年第4期24-27,共4页Journal of Zhengzhou Railway Vocational and Technical College

摘  要:以AT89S52单片机为核心,设计了一种带温度补偿的超声波测距系统。系统包括单片机、超声波发射及接收模块、温度补偿模块、信息显示模块。温度补偿模块采用温度传感器DSl8B20采集环境温度,根据超声波速度与温度值的对应关系及时修正波速,以纠正温度的变化引起超声波测距系统产生的误差。测试结果表明:该系统能够有效地避免温度的变化对测距系统造成误差,其测量相对误差可小于1%,测量范围为0.1~5m。A kind of ultrasonic ranging system with the temperature compensation is designed,which takes AT89S52 MCU as the core. The system hardware consists of MCU,temperature compensation module,ultrasonic transmitting and receiving module,information display module. The temperature compensation module using the temperature sensor DSl8B20 to gather the real-time temperature data,then the microcontroller corrects the ultrasonic velocity according to the environmental temperature to correct the error of the ultrasonic ranging system caused by the the change in temperature. The actual test results show that the system can effectively avoid the error caused by the change in temperature,the measuring relative error is less than 1%,the measuring range is 0. 1 ~ 5 m.

关 键 词:MCU 超声波测距 温度补偿 

分 类 号:TP368[自动化与计算机技术—计算机系统结构]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象